Output bbab895c126d27b6922f1c2a7f4fa4e885f1e1c58dbd573a55ebe4add88053a8:0

value
159900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 643a0aba46a43fbaab539f1c381b273c791d6a02 OP_EQUAL
address
3Apy2YoEqYfmggeaPXnYzVZ8xcrsVbRBMQ
transaction
bbab895c126d27b6922f1c2a7f4fa4e885f1e1c58dbd573a55ebe4add88053a8